Streamline Localization Through Strategic Citations
Citations form the backbone of local SEO credibility. List your business consistently across authoritative directories like Yelp, Bing Places, and industry-specific sites. Focus on accuracy and completeness—name, address, phone number, and website should match exactly across all listings. Use citation cleanup tools if discrepancies arise. When I optimized citations for a local restaurant, I discovered that correcting outdated NAP info from secondary sources increased visibility within weeks. How do I maintain long-term map ranking success without falling prey to fluctuations?
Consistent upkeep is crucial to sustaining your map pack prominence. I personally rely on a combination of advanced tools and disciplined routines to keep my clients’ listings performing optimally. One tool I swear by is BrightLocal, which offers comprehensive local SEO audits that help identify hidden issues before they impact rankings. Regularly auditing your citations, reviews, and profile activity ensures your signals stay healthy and aligned with Google’s evolving algorithms—especially since insider strategies for 2025 predict greater automation and signal decay if neglected.
In addition to software, establishing a standardized routine—such as weekly review of profile Insights, monthly citation checks, and quarterly review of NAP consistency—creates a proactive maintenance cycle. This disciplined approach prevents small issues from snowballing into ranking declines. For instance, I tell my team to set calendar reminders for targeted updates, ensuring every profile remains current and authoritative.
